Andy logo Andy

The Andy operating system is an Android emulator, which means you can play mobile games and open mobile apps in a version of the Android operating system on your Windows or Mac desktop. Read more about Andy.

mGBA logo mGBA

mGBA is an open source emulator of the Game Boy Advance. The goals are speed and accuracy.
